Panasonic Electric Works AQV414AZ technical specifications, attributes, parameters and parts with similar specifications to Panasonic Electric Works AQV414AZ.
- Factory Lead Time12 Weeks
- MountSurface Mount
- Mounting TypeSurface Mount
- Package / Case6-SMD (0.300, 7.62mm)
- Number of Pins6
- PackagingTape & Reel (TR)
- SeriesPhotoMOS™ AQV
- Published2005
- Pbfree Codeyes
- Part StatusActive
- Moisture Sensitivity Level (MSL)3 (168 Hours)
- TerminationGull Wing
- Resistance50Ohm
- Max Operating Temperature85°C
- Min Operating Temperature-40°C
- Additional FeatureHIGH SENSITIVITY
- HTS Code8541.40.95.00
- Termination StyleGull Wing
- Output Voltage400V
- Output TypeAC, DC
- Max Output Current120mA
- Number of Elements1
- CircuitSPST-NC (1 Form B)
- Voltage - Input1.14VDC
- Output Current120mA
- Throw ConfigurationSPST
- Optoelectronic Device TypeTRANSISTOR OUTPUT SSR
- Max Output Voltage400V
- Relay TypeRelay
- Voltage - Load0V~400V
- Forward Current-Max0.05A
- On-State Resistance (Max)50Ohm
- Max Input Current50mA
- Input Current50mA
- On-State Current-Max0.12A
- Isolation Voltage1.5kV
- Test Voltage1.5kV
- Height3.6mm
- Length8.8mm
- Width6.4mm
- Radiation HardeningNo
- RoHS StatusRoHS Compliant
- Lead FreeLead Free
